Transaction 59bc6e9aaf39927c83d987222f40a7195127c2fe4a83bf82de3f25857c71b384
1 Input
1 Output
-
59bc6e9aaf39927c83d987222f40a7195127c2fe4a83bf82de3f25857c71b384:0
- value
- 20644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9071099c1df9d140a1b61e34887882dee453508c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EAjicM9njQweeDQpwBGcRtzvc22iKqsHB